A Study on the Safety and Immunogenicity of Influenza, Respiratory Syncytial Virus, Human Metapneumovirus and Parainfluenza Vaccines in Adults 18 to 49 Years of Age.

What it studies

Conditions

  • Healthy Volunteers
  • Influenza Vaccination
  • Respiratory Syncytial Virus Vaccination
  • Parainfluenza Vaccination
  • Human Metapneumovirus Vaccination

Interventions

  • Biological: TIV-HA Vaccine formulation 1 at low dose
  • Biological: TIV-HA formulation 1 at high dose
  • Biological: TIV-HA formulation 2 at low dose
  • Biological: TIV-HA formulation 2 at high dose
  • Biological: RSV/hMPV/PIV3 formulation 2 at low dose
  • Biological: RSV/hMPV/PIV3 formulation 1 at high dose
  • Biological: RSV/hMPV/PIV3 formulation 2 at high dose
  • Biological: RSV/hMPV/PIV3 formulation 1 at low dose
  • Biological: RIV4 (Supemtek®)

Primary outcomes

what the primary-completion date above is the date OF
Presence of any unsolicited systemic Adverse Events (AEs) reported within 30 minutes after vaccination
measured Within 30 minutes after each vaccination
Presence of solicited injection site and systemic reactions (ie, pre-listed in the participant's diary and in the eCRF (electronic case report form) occurring through 7 days after vaccination
measured Through 7 days after each vaccination
Presence of unsolicited AEs reported through 28 days after vaccination
measured Through 28 days after each vaccination
Presence of SAEs (Serious Adverse Events) and AESIs (Adverse Events of Special Interest) throughout the study
measured Throughout study, approximately 6 months
Presence of out-of-range biological test results (including shift from baseline values) through 7 days after vaccination
measured Through 7 days after vaccination
Hemagglutinin Inhibition Assay (HAI) antibody (Ab) response to each homologous influenza strain at Day 1 and Day 29
measured Day 1 and Day 29
RSV A, hMPV A and PIV3 serum neutralizing antibodies (nAb) titers at Day 1 and Day 29
measured Day 1 and Day 29
